Florida and Texas Aquastore utilize the glass-fused-to-steel tank which is bolted together and sealed with a moisture-cured urethane compound. This technology has become the premium water and liquid storage solution due to its dependable performance and minimal maintenance costs. The factory-applied silica glass coating ensures a fast and consistent field assembly that is not hindered by weather delays or environmental elements.

Potable Water

Municipalities and industrial customers can count on the longevity and durability of our tanks.  The coating technology is a single, integrated glass and steel material fused together at 1500° F in a controlled process furnace. The physical properties of the glass-fused-to-steel technology are ideally suited for long-life critical infrastructure projects.  Your reservoir or standpipe can be designed to a wide range of standards featuring AWWA D103-09.

WASTEWater

Glass-fused-to-steel is the preferred choice for municipal wastewater engineers due to its protection against aggressive gasses with absolutely no UV degradation over time. Our treatment tanks can be designed to accommodate any wastewater equipment, walkways, or loads and can be fitted with a corrosion resistant aluminum dome.

composite elevated tank

Never repaint your elevated tank again!  The importance of the corrosion resistance and minimal maintenance is elevated to new heights with our Composite Elevated Tank.  We utilize a hollow jump form concrete pedestal with our glass-fused-to-steel tank and aluminum dome on top.  Our corrosion resistant CET is redefining the market with over 150 elevated structures installed across the country.

leachate

Leachate is a highly corrosive liquid that seeps through solid waste landfills and is collected, stored and treated.  Our primary and secondary containment tanks featuring glass- fused-to-steel technology offer proven solutions for containment and treatment with hundreds of landfill leachate applications in operations
